The Art Of Julienne: Precision Cutting Technique For Perfect Texture

French cuisine demands mastery of fundamental techniques, and the julienne stands as one of the most essential cuts in professional kitchens. This deceptively simple method—transforming vegetables into uniform matchsticks—requires the precision that separates polished dishes from mediocre ones.

Begin by washing 600g of potatoes and one carrot thoroughly, then peel both with meticulous care. The next step demands attention: slice each vegetable into thin sheets of exactly 3mm thickness. This uniformity matters profoundly—inconsistent sizing leads to uneven cooking, leaving some pieces undercooked while others turn mushy. Once sliced, stack these sheets and carefully cut them into 3mm bâtonnets, creating the characteristic matchstick strips that define a proper julienne.

Advertisement:

The precision here isn’t merely aesthetic. Uniform dimensions ensure even heat distribution during cooking, guaranteeing that every vegetable reaches the ideal texture simultaneously. This consistency becomes crucial when paired with delicate proteins like scallops, where vegetables must maintain their firmness without dominating the plate.

Transfer your carefully cut julienne to a steam basket, ready for the gentle cooking method that preserves both texture and nutrients. The architecture of your cut determines everything that follows.

Steam Cooking: The Gentle Method For Preserving Vegetable Integrity

With your julienne precisely cut and arranged in the steam basket, the cooking phase demands equally careful attention. Bring a pot of water to a rolling boil and position the basket above the surface, ensuring steam circulates freely around every matchstick. This gentle cooking method preserves both the delicate texture and nutritional value that sharp knife work alone cannot guarantee.

Monitor the vegetables closely for approximately 10 minutes. The critical benchmark is firmness—potatoes and carrots should yield slightly to a fork without crumbling or becoming mushy. This distinction separates restaurant-quality vegetables from those that collapse during plating. Visual inspection proves more reliable than rigid timing; some stovetops cook faster than others, so check regularly and extend cooking by another minute or two if needed.

The risk of overcooking cannot be overstated. Vegetables that become too tender will inevitably break apart when transferred to the plate, destroying the elegant presentation you’ve worked to achieve. Maintain structural integrity throughout by removing the basket the moment vegetables reach that perfect tender-firm balance. This vigilance transforms a simple side into a showcase of culinary restraint.

Searing Scallops: Timing And Temperature For Restaurant-Quality Results

As your vegetables reach that perfect tender-firm state, the stage belongs entirely to the scallops. Heat the 20g of butter in a large skillet over medium-high flame until it shimmers with barely perceptible movement—this is the threshold where heat transforms protein into golden perfection. The timing here separates amateur cooks from kitchen professionals: rush the temperature and butter burns; hesitate and scallops emerge rubbery rather than tender.

Advertisement:

Slide the 16 scallops into the hot butter and resist the urge to move them. A mere 1-2 minutes per side creates that signature caramelized crust while preserving the delicate, buttery interior that defines restaurant-quality preparation. Overcrowding the pan invites steaming rather than searing, so work in batches if necessary. Once both sides achieve that golden-brown seal, transfer the scallops to a plate.

Return the skillet to heat for the coral—that prized nugget of richness—requiring barely 30 seconds of attention. Its brief exposure prevents the delicate flavor from overwhelming the dish’s balance. A final seasoning of salt and pepper across both scallops and coral completes this phase of transformation.

Your proteins now rest, ready for their place atop the vegetables you’ve so carefully preserved. The final assembly awaits.

Elegant Plating: Assembling A Refined Four-Person Dish

The moment of transformation arrives—where technique yields to artistry. Begin by distributing the julienne vegetables evenly across each of four plates, creating a delicate foundation that anchors the entire composition. This base layer, still warm and holding its firm texture, establishes both structural integrity and visual sophistication.

Position your seared scallops and coral deliberately atop this vegetable bed, allowing their golden surfaces to command attention without overwhelming the palate. The arrangement matters: each plate should mirror its companions, demonstrating the deliberate sequencing that defines restaurant presentation. This layering—vegetables first, protein second—builds flavor complexity while maintaining visual hierarchy.

Advertisement:

Crown each plate with a handful of fresh arugula leaves, their peppery character cutting through the richness of butter and scallop. The greens introduce textural contrast and aromatic brightness essential to balance. Finish with a modest drizzle of excellent olive oil, allowing it to pool slightly around the vegetables and coat the scallops with glossy refinement.

What emerges on the plate tells a complete story: humble ingredients elevated through precision and respect. The 35-minute journey from preparation to plating demonstrates how simple components—600g potatoes, a carrot, butter, and 16 scallops—transform into a sophisticated four-person dish. Each element holds its purpose, each technique serves the whole, and each plate becomes a quiet statement of culinary intentionality.
